پاٹ
पाट
Pāṭ,
m.
breadth (of cloth or of a river ) ; tow ; it also signifies a note or obligation to pay a sum of money for one's own account on an appointed day. It is often usual to accept these pāṭs from creditable persons, in payment of the arrears of the zamīndārs or renters. h.
پاٹ
पाट
Pāṭ,
m.
silk ; a millstone ; a throne, a seat ; a baord, shutter, plank, flap ; a plank on which washermen beat clothes, the leaf of a door. S.
